GNU/Linux >> Znalost Linux >  >> Linux

Linux Shutdown Command:5 praktických příkladů

V Linuxu existuje vyhrazený příkaz pro vypnutí systému. Nepřekvapivě se tomu říká vypnutí.

Než se podíváme na použití příkazu shutdown, podívejme se nejprve na jeho syntaxi.

shutdown [options] [time] [message]
  • Možnosti:Můžete určit, zda se chcete zastavit, vypnout, restartovat atd
  • čas:Můžete určit, kdy se má provést vypnutí
  • zpráva:Všem přihlášeným uživatelům ve vašem systému Linux můžete poslat vlastní zprávu

Poznámka:Příkaz k vypnutí vyžaduje oprávnění superuživatele. Proto byste měli být buď root, nebo spustit příkaz pomocí sudo.

5 praktických příkladů příkazu k vypnutí v Linuxu

Nyní, když znáte syntaxi příkazu shutdown, pojďme se podívat, jak jej používat.

Pokud jednoduše použijete příkaz k vypnutí, spustí se proces vypnutí po jedné minutě. Pamatujte tedy, že výchozí časový interval pro příkaz k vypnutí je jedna minuta.

sudo shutdown
Shutdown scheduled for Mon 2018-11-19 11:33:36 UTC, use 'shutdown -c' to cancel.

Nic netušící uživatelé Linuxu očekávají, že příkaz k vypnutí okamžitě vypne systém, ale když uvidí zprávu podobnou této s časovým razítkem v UTC, jsou často zmateni.

1. Okamžitě vypněte systém

Nemusíte vždy čekat jednu minutu, než se systém vypne. Systém můžete okamžitě vypnout zadáním plánovaného času +0 nebo teď .

sudo shutdown now

2. Naplánujte vypnutí systému

V budoucnu můžete naplánovat vypnutí zadáním časového argumentu buď ve formátu +t, nebo ve formátu hh:mm.

Pokud například chcete vypnout systém po 15 minutách, můžete použít tento příkaz:

sudo shutdown +15

Pokud chcete systém vypnout v 16:00 odpoledne, můžete jej použít následujícím způsobem:

sudo shutdown 16:00

Netřeba dodávat, že referenční čas a časové pásmo je samotný systémový čas.

Pět minut před plánovaným vypnutím systém nepovolí žádnou přihlašovací aktivitu. Což znamená, že nový uživatel se nemůže přihlásit do systému do pěti minut od plánovaného vypnutí.

3. Restartujte systém příkazem vypnutí

Existuje samostatný příkaz pro restart, ale nemusíte se učit nový příkaz pouze pro restartování systému. Pro restartování můžete také použít příkaz Linux shutdown.

Chcete-li restartovat systém Linux pomocí příkazu shutdown, použijte -r možnost.

sudo shutdown -r

Chování je stejné jako u běžného příkazu k vypnutí. Jde jen o to, že namísto vypnutí bude systém restartován.

Pokud jste tedy použili shutdown -r bez jakéhokoli časového argumentu naplánuje restart po jedné minutě.

Restartování můžete naplánovat stejným způsobem jako při vypnutí.

sudo shutdown -r +30

Systém můžete také okamžitě restartovat příkazem k vypnutí:

sudo shutdown -r now

4. Vysílejte zprávu o vypnutí

Pokud se nacházíte v prostředí s více uživateli a v systému je přihlášeno několik uživatelů, můžete jim poslat vlastní zprávu vysílání pomocí příkazu k vypnutí.

Ve výchozím nastavení obdrží všichni přihlášení uživatelé upozornění o plánovaném vypnutí a jeho čase. Vysílanou zprávu můžete upravit v samotném příkazu k vypnutí:

sudo shutdown 16:00 "systems will be shutdown for hardware upgrade, please save your work"
Zábavné věci:Můžete použít příkaz k vypnutí s volbou -k k zahájení „falešného vypnutí“. Nevypne systém, ale vysílaná zpráva bude odeslána všem přihlášeným uživatelům. K znamená srandu.

5. Zrušit plánované vypnutí

Pokud jste naplánovali vypnutí, nemusíte s tím žít. Vypnutí můžete kdykoli zrušit pomocí volby -c .

sudo shutdown -c

A pokud jste odvysílali zprávu o plánovaném vypnutí, jako správný správce systému můžete také chtít upozornit ostatní uživatele na zrušení plánovaného vypnutí.

sudo shutdown -c "planned shutdown has been cancelled"

Bonus:Kontrola souborového systému při restartu

Můžete vynutit kontrolu souborového systému při příštím restartu pomocí volby -F. Takže pokud jej použijete s některou z výše uvedených možností příkazu shutdown, provede kontrolu souborového systému, když se systém znovu spustí.

Podobně můžete použít parametr -f k přeskočení kontroly souborového systému.

Bonus:Zastavení versus vypnutí

Halt (volba -H):ukončí všechny procesy a vypne procesor.
Vypnutí (volba -P):Skoro jako zastavení, ale také vypne samotnou jednotku (světla a vše v systému).

Historicky dřívější počítače používaly k zastavení systému a následnému vytištění zprávy jako „je v pořádku nyní vypnout“ a poté byly počítače vypnuty fyzickými přepínači.

V těchto dnech by měl halt automaticky vypnout systém díky ACPI.

Toto byly nejběžnější a nejužitečnější příklady příkazu Linux shutdown. Doufám, že jste se naučili, jak vypnout systém Linux pomocí příkazového řádku. Možná byste si také rádi přečetli o menším používání příkazů nebo si prohlédli seznam příkazů Linuxu, které jsme doposud probrali.

Pokud máte nějaké dotazy nebo návrhy, neváhejte mi dát vědět v sekci komentářů.


Linux
  1. 10 Praktické příklady příkazů Linux nm

  2. 7 Příklady příkazů Linux df

  3. 8 Příklady příkazů Linux TR

  1. cp Command v Linuxu:7 praktických příkladů

  2. Příklady příkazů „shutdown“ v Linuxu

  3. sa Příklady příkazů v Linuxu

  1. 5 Praktické příklady příkazu dd v Linuxu

  2. Příklady příkazů rm v Linuxu

  3. Příklady příkazů ps v Linuxu